Name Richardson Robert Starkie
Army number 4454418
Rank Pte
Decorations
Date of birth Born 1918/19.
Age 21
Unit Joined The Durham Light Infantry, T, no enlistment date as yet, but probably early 1939. Posted ? 9th Bn DLI. Posted ? 12th Bn DLI - probably 1/9/1939. Transferred to the Black Watch 1/2/1940, posted 1 TS. Served BEF. Presumed KILLED in ACTION between 29th and 30th May 1940 with B.E.F., Serial No. 516 9/10/44, while with 1st Tyneside Scottish.

Joined Brigade Probably 1/9/1939.

Died/Killed in action 29-May-40.
Home address Adopted son and nephew of Sarah A Buchanan, Blaydon. Death may have occurred up to 30 5 1940. Commemorated Column 91, Dunkirk Memorial.
